When can I apply to have my enforcement order heard in court?

You can apply for the annulment of an enforcement order only if the fine has not been already heard in court.

If a court has heard the fine and you want to contest the ruling, you will need to contact the issuing court to determine what avenues of appeal are open to you. If there is no avenue of appeal, you will need to pay the enforcement order.
